Subject: [PATCH] regulator: max20086: Fix refcount leak in max20086_parse_regulators_dt()
Date: Tue, 27 May 2025 08:44:14 +0300 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<aDVRLqgJWMxYU03G@stanley.mountain> (raw)
There is a missing call to of_node_put() if devm_kcalloc() fails.
Fix this by changing the code to use cleanup.h magic to drop the
refcount.
Fixes: 6b0cd72757c6 ("regulator: max20086: fix invalid memory access")
Signed-off-by: Dan Carpenter <dan.carpenter@linaro.org>
---
drivers/regulator/max20086-regulator.c | 6 +++---
1 file changed, 3 insertions(+), 3 deletions(-)
diff --git a/drivers/regulator/max20086-regulator.c b/drivers/regulator/max20086-regulator.c
index b4fe76e33ff2..fcdd2d0317a5 100644
--- a/drivers/regulator/max20086-regulator.c
+++ b/drivers/regulator/max20086-regulator.c
@@ -5,6 +5,7 @@
// Copyright (C) 2022 Laurent Pinchart <laurent.pinchart@idesonboard.com>
// Copyright (C) 2018 Avnet, Inc.
+#include <linux/cleanup.h>
#include <linux/err.h>
#include <linux/gpio/consumer.h>
#include <linux/i2c.h>
@@ -133,11 +134,11 @@ static int max20086_regulators_register(struct max20086 *chip)
static int max20086_parse_regulators_dt(struct max20086 *chip, bool *boot_on)
{
struct of_regulator_match *matches;
- struct device_node *node;
unsigned int i;
int ret;
- node = of_get_child_by_name(chip->dev->of_node, "regulators");
+ struct device_node *node __free(device_node) =
+ of_get_child_by_name(chip->dev->of_node, "regulators");
if (!node) {
dev_err(chip->dev, "regulators node not found\n");
return -ENODEV;
@@ -153,7 +154,6 @@ static int max20086_parse_regulators_dt(struct max20086 *chip, bool *boot_on)
ret = of_regulator_match(chip->dev, node, matches,
chip->info->num_outputs);
- of_node_put(node);
if (ret < 0) {
dev_err(chip->dev, "Failed to match regulators\n");
return -EINVAL;
